How dynamic are these reports? And how many are there?
What about creating page fragments for each one and including the one
picked either with a jsp:include or a facelets ui:include?
If you really want to manually create components, the way to go about
it is to bind a panelGrour to your page, and then manually set up
everything with that binding getter.
You also MUST manually specific all required attributes (for example,
id) as part of this creation process.
However, I'd avoid creating components in java code if you can do so.
If it's just a matter of dynamically creating columns, use t:columns.

Thanks, Mike. I'm creating the components within the backing bean. Here is
how:
Jsp.~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
<f:view>
<h:form id="selectorForm">
<h:panelGrid footerClass="subtitle" headerClass=""
styleClass=""
columnClasses=""
binding="#{selector.panelGrid}">
Backing bean~~~~~~~~~~~~~
public HtmlPanelGrid getPanelGrid() {
grid = new HtmlPanelGrid();
grid.setColumns(4);
grid.setBgcolor("red");
HtmlSelectOneMenu chooser = new HtmlSelectOneMenu();
chooser.setId("reportsOfCategory");
chooser.setTitle("Please select a report to run");
chooser.getChildren().add(ReportsPerCategoryMapper.getOptionItems(this.getCategory().getName()));
grid.getChildren().add(chooser);
return grid;
}
What I don't know is how to make the backing bean build the rest of the
components after chooser passes it the report selected.

> I'm looking for some code samples to support the following use case:
>
> I have a page with a form on which there's a combo-box (h:selectOneMenu).
> The combo-box contains a list of available reports. Depending on the
> user choice in the combo-box, I'd like to redisplay the same page with
> the combo-box with a dynamically generated list of components
> representing the user controls corresponding to the chosen report's
> parameters list to be passed to the server. User then populates these
> controls with the parameter values and submits the form by clicking the
submit button.
>
> The part that interests me most is: how to redisplay the same page
> with these newly populated controls after the selectOneMenu event
> passed to the server.
